Почему мое веб-приложение не работает в Android Studio - PullRequest
0 голосов
/ 26 сентября 2019

У меня есть простое веб-приложение, которое мне нужно перенести в Android Studio.Он работает безупречно в обычном веб-браузере, но не тогда, когда я запускаю его в Android Studio.

Это мое основное действие `открытый класс MainActivity расширяет AppCompatActivity {

@Override
protected void onCreate(Bundle savedInstanceState) {
    super.onCreate(savedInstanceState);
    setContentView(R.layout.activity_main);
    String myUrl = "file:///android_asset/index.html";
    WebView view = findViewById(R.id.webView);
    view.getSettings().setJavaScriptEnabled(true);
    view.getSettings().setDomStorageEnabled(true);
    view.setWebChromeClient(new WebChromeClient());
    view.loadUrl(myUrl);

    view.setWebViewClient(new WebViewClient() {
        @Override
        public boolean shouldOverrideUrlLoading(WebView view, String myUrl) {
            view.loadUrl(myUrl);
            return true;
        }
    });
}

}`

HTML использует JavaScript и JQuery.Все файлы хранятся в папке Assests.Я добавил разрешение на доступ в интернет к манифесту.Я даже не уверен, что еще попробовать.Приложение отображается правильно, но не имеет никакой функциональности.Я чувствую, что это не работает с JS или JQuery.Мой jquery обрабатывает вызовы API и изменяет элементы DOM.Любая помощь будет принята с благодарностью.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...